Islamabad- US President donald Trump thanks Pakistan for release of Taliban hostages
Islamabad, Thanks to the US President for his cooperation in the release of foreigners, PM Imran
US President Trump has said Pakistan is thankful for facilitating the release of abductees in Afghanistan, he said while talking to Prime Minister Imran Khan over the telephone.
Prime Minister Imran Khan and US President Donald Trump have telephonic contact, Pakistan-US bilateral relations and regional issues were discussed in the talks.
Talking to the US President about the release of the abductors from Afghanistan, Prime Minister Imran Khan said that the release of the abductees is a positive development.
US President Donald Trump thanked the Prime Minister for facilitating the release of the abductors. On this occasion, Afghan leaders were also discussed between the two leaders.
In addition, the Prime Minister apprised President Trump of the recent situation in occupied Kashmir. Imran Khan said that over a hundred days, 80 million Kashmiris are still locked in their homes.
Appreciating Trump's ongoing efforts for mediation, Donald Trump should continue his efforts for a peaceful resolution of the Kashmir issue.
On the occasion, the leaders agreed to continue the close relations between the two countries and also to strengthen bilateral relations in the context of meetings and talks held in Washington.
